As you can see here in the promo image below, you'll be able to snag a special 35th Anniversary Edition for both consoles, which comes with an array of items for you to enjoy. Now those six titles will be sold as a complete collection for both platforms sometime in the Spring of 2023. The company already released all six games individually through Steam over the course of 2022, bringing the classic '80s and '90s titles with full translations over to a modern platform for you to experience. There will be a limited run of physical editions in both a $74.99 standard edition and a $259.99 FF35th Anniversary Edition, which are available to pre-order now exclusively through Square Enix’s online stores in North America and Europe.Square Enix confirmed when they will finally be releasing the Final Fantasy Pixel Remaster collection for both Nintendo Switch and PlayStation. Square Enix also announced that there will be physical copies of the collection available, released as Final Fantasy I-VI Collection. Players will be able to purchase a digital bundle containing the Pixel Remaster versions of Final Fantasy, Final Fantasy II, Final Fantasy III, Final Fantasy IV, Final Fantasy V, and Final Fantasy VI - which are currently available on PC, iOS, and Android - or all of the games individually. On the 35th anniversary of the first game’s release in Japan, Square Enix announced that its Final Fantasy Pixel Remaster collection will be released for PlayStation 4 and Nintendo Switch.
